The initial samba college, Deixa Falar, is based inside 1928 regarding the Estácio area away from Rio. It designated a significant move, because the samba schools started initially to formalize the fresh teaching and gratification out of samba. Nonetheless they arrive at plan out parades through the Carnival, and that quickly turned perhaps one of the most envisioned situations inside the Brazilian people. Over the years, far more samba colleges emerged, for each representing various other communities and you can communities.

A brief history from Samba inside the Brazil
Samba sounds turned into well-accepted inside the song from and many of it’s earliest tracks date back so you can 1911. Sambas of the 1920s as well as the radio era of your 1930s had been slow and you may close and birthed a sub-genre known as “samba-cancao”. During this period of the 1930s, these types of dance try introduced to your Us because of a popular Broadway enjoy and also at the fresh York Globe’s Reasonable. Because of the 1950s samba cancao turned overshadowed by samba de batucada, a far more percussive and you will groovy kind of samba. By the 1970s samba spotted they’s increase while the performers modernized the fresh vibrant samba batacuda design and you may bonded it which have modern balance and you will instrumentation.
